Output 2e40cdfdaba9e4748bff47b328101f8cf06a96cd88b4e04c8fe494c2b8dc61e6:0

value
36043277
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18804356e3a7946b55cb7f2945f3b51a92fb11e2 OP_EQUAL
address
33vZo28Pxd3TBsReJeRjPFf5CanwKV3d6A
transaction
2e40cdfdaba9e4748bff47b328101f8cf06a96cd88b4e04c8fe494c2b8dc61e6
confirmations
496121
spent
true